Nova

A site building framework for people who like to keep it simple.


Installation

pip install nova-framework

For the latest development version:

pip install git+https://github.com/iiPythonx/nova

Configuration and usage

To initialize a Nova project, just run nova init and follow the instructions:

🚀 Nova 0.1.0 | Project Initialization
Source location (default: src): src/
Destination location (default: dist): dist/

Afterwards, put your Jinja2 and other assets inside your configured source folder.
To launch a development server, you can run nova serve --reload to get a hot-reloading capable web server.


To build your app for production, just run nova build. It will spit out a static site in your configured destination path.
